This engaging exploration digs deep into the fascinating origins of the holiday's most cherished customs, from the symbolism of lilies and lambs to the global variations of Easter egg hunts. Ace Collins masterfully connects the ancient roots of these practices to the modern celebrations we know today, providing a rich historical context for the season's music and rituals. Readers will discover the surprising backstories behind beloved hymns and the evolution of community traditions that define the spring holiday. This is far more than a surface-level guide; it's a cultural and historical deep dive into the very fabric of Easter observance.
What sets this book apart is its ability to make historical research feel immediately relevant and surprisingly compelling, transforming familiar traditions into layered stories with profound meaning. Anyone who has ever wondered why we dye eggs, what connects bunnies to resurrection, or how specific songs became Easter anthems will find their curiosity thoroughly satisfied. Collins delivers a work that will permanently enrich how you experience the holiday, making it an essential read for families, church groups, and history buffs seeking to understand the deeper significance behind the celebrations.
